Model Value Embedding / 模型价值观嵌入

Model value embedding is the claim that a large model’s outputs reflect the data, rewards, post-training choices, product policies, and institutional contexts that shaped it. In 174. 我们还能给算法当多久的品味老师?|对谈亚马逊AGI查晟, 查晟 / Cha Sheng argues that language models are built from human symbols rather than direct access to reality, so their apparent neutrality is a product surface over selected data and reward signals.

The concept complements AI Model Value Surveying. Surveying measures output tendencies after the fact; value embedding asks how those tendencies enter the model through training and governance. Key Claims

  • Model values can enter through pretraining data, filtering, reward design, post-training, product policy, and deployment context.
  • Neutrality should be treated as an interface claim, not as proof that no values were selected.
  • Value embedding matters more when models advise users, represent companies, or become national information infrastructure.
  • Enterprise and national model ownership are partly value-control strategies, not only cost or accuracy strategies.
  • Alignment governance has to govern the people and institutions shaping model values, not only the final output behavior.
